How does pelvic inflammatory disease develop?

Pelvic inflammatory disease is a common gynecological inflammation problem. The reason for pelvic inflammatory disease is often caused by some bad habits, such as lack of attention to health and hygiene in the tourism economy, frequent abortions, and inflammation of some adjacent organs that spread to each other, which can lead to pelvic inflammatory disease.

1. Not paying attention to hygiene during menstruation: During menstruation, the endometrium is exfoliated, the blood sinuses in the uterine cavity are open, and blood clots exist, which are good conditions for bacterial growth. If you do not pay attention to hygiene during menstruation, use sanitary napkins or toilet paper that do not meet hygiene standards, or have sexual intercourse, it will provide bacteria with an opportunity for retrograde infection and lead to pelvic inflammatory disease.

2. Postpartum or post-abortion infection: The patient is weak after childbirth or miscarriage, and the cervical opening has not yet closed well after dilation. At this time, the bacteria in the vagina and cervix may ascend and infect the pelvic cavity.

3. Infection after gynecological surgery: During artificial abortion, IUD insertion or removal, tubal insufflation, salpingography, endometrial polyp removal, or submucosal uterine myoma removal, if the disinfection is not strict or there is chronic inflammation of the reproductive system, postoperative infection may occur. Some patients do not pay attention to personal hygiene after surgery, or do not follow the doctor's orders after surgery and resume sexual life too early, which can also allow bacteria to ascend and cause pelvic inflammatory disease.

4. Spread of inflammation to adjacent organs: The most common occurrence is when appendicitis and peritonitis occur. Since they are adjacent to the female internal reproductive organs, the inflammation can spread directly and cause female pelvic inflammation. When suffering from chronic cervicitis, the inflammation can also cause pelvic connective tissue inflammation through the lymphatic circulation.
